Taylor Swift is many things.
Among them is self-aware.
That much was made clear in the new teaser for her highly anticipated appearance on New Heights, which will be released at 7 p.m. ET on Wednesday night. In the clip, the “Shake It Off” singer sits beside her boyfriend, Travis Kelce, as his brother, Jason Kelce, performs a pro wrestling-style introduction for perhaps the most highly anticipated podcast guest in the platform’s history.
“Thanks for having me on my favorite podcast,” Swift says after being welcomed to the show by Travis. “As we all know, you guys have a lot of male sports fans that listen to your podcast. And I think we all know that if there’s one thing that male sports fans want to see in their spaces and on their screens, it’s more of me.”

Swift’s comment comes in reference to the almost immediate backlash directed at her from a certain section of sports fans who have taken issue with the amount of airtime her presence at Kansas City Chiefs games has received. In the time since she and Travis first began dating in 2023, it’s been common to hear complaints about broadcasts constantly cutting away from the game to show her in a suite, even if she hasn’t actually been focused on as often as they’d have you believe.
Was there a lot of attention paid to to the Kelce-Swift relationship early on in their courtship? Of course. And that seems understandable considering that one of the NFL’s most famous players was dating the world’s biggest music star. But all things considered, their relationship was much more low key throughout the 2024 campaign and the couple has largely been absent from the spotlight throughout most of the ongoing offseason.
That, however, appears to be changing, with Taylor using her New Heights appearance to announce her highly anticipated upcoming album, “The Life of a Showgirl.” Meanwhile, Travis Kelce was recently featured in a profile (and accompanying photoshoot) for GQ, in which he admitted that his Hollywood ambitions may have hampered his on-field performance.
Yet despite Kelce insisting that he’s fully focused on winning another Super Bowl, it sure seems like America’s most famous couple is kicking off some sort of publicity tour. And that begins with the upcoming episode of New Heights, which has already become one of the most talked-about podcast episodes ever before it has even been published.
